A fire was burning, and she still held Drake's letter in her hand.

'We might keep it to ourselves,' she said diffidently.

She saw Drake's forehead contract.
'For my sake,' she said softly, laying a hand upon his sleeve.

She lifted a tear-stained face up to his with the prettiest appeal.

'I know you hate it, but it will spare me so much.' He said nothing, and she dropped the letter into the fire.
As Drake was leaving the house she heard, through the closed door, the sound of her father's voice in the hall speaking to him, and felt a momentary pang of alarm.
